Skip to content

Projeto desenvolvido para impor o método Pomodoro aos seus estudos

License

Notifications You must be signed in to change notification settings

DinowSauron/Projeto-Next-Level-Week-4

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

9 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Projeto-Next-Level-Week-4


Neste projeto desenvolvido durante a Next Level Week realizada pela @Rocketseat Tivemos o projeto Chamado Move-it, um projeto baseado no metodo de pomodoro, com uma gameficaçãoa fim de fazer as pessoas cumprirem corretamente os as regras...

Este projeto foi feito do inicio ao fim, incluse com deploy! Confira clicando AQUI

WebSite   |    Funcionalidades   |    Layout   |    Licença

Fotos Da Aplicação:

Main app

Funcionalidades:

  • Temporizador de 25 minutos para focar em estudos/trabalho etc...
  • Sistema de desafios para quanod acabar o tempo que podem ou não ser executados.
  • Sistema de nivel conforma se completa os dasafios.
  • Aviso sonoro do termino do tempo.
  • Notificação do termino do tempo.
  • Salvamento dos dados via cookies.

Tecnologias utilizadas

  • React.js
  • React-Dom
  • Next.js
  • Typescript
  • js-cookie
  • CSS3

Layout

Você pode visualizar o layout do projeto através dos links abaixo:

Licença

Note que este projeto está sob a licensa MIT. Veja o arquivo para mais detalhes: LICENSE




Comandos utilizados durante o evento:

OBS: note que não é um tutorial de como executar a aplicação, isto são os comandos anotados, claro que com eles você pode saber como executar a aplicação, basta ler oque cada comando executa.

Projeto React

  • yarn create react-app moveit --template=typescript
    • Cria a base do projeto React.
  • cd moveit
    • Entra na pasta do projeto.
  • yarn start
    • Inicializa a aplicação do react (abre um browser)

Projeto React em Next.js

  • yarn add package.json *instala as dependencias.
  • yarn create next-app movit-next
    • Cria uma base com next.js.
  • cd movit-next
    • Entra na pasta do projeto.
  • yarn add typescript @types/react @types/react-dom @types/node -D
    • Adiciona typescript ao projeto, com modo de desenvolvimento, não vai para produção.
  • yarn add js-cookie
    • Blibioteca que ajuda na criação de cookies.
  • yarn add @types/js-cookie -D
    • adiciona o typescript apenas na produção, não para o projeto final, já que tudo se transformará em javascript
  • yarn dev
    • Inicializa a aplicação do react (abre um browser)
  • vercel
  • vercel --prod

Notações:

#rumoaoproximonivel; https://undraw.co/illustrations; whimsical; Netlify; 20:00/5 explicação ServerSide(next back-end); 40:00/5 Deploy;

About

Projeto desenvolvido para impor o método Pomodoro aos seus estudos

Topics

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published